#1 Black Fox Nuclear Power Plant
The Black Fox Nuclear Power Plant was a nuclear power plant proposed by the Public Service Company of Oklahoma (PSO) in May 1973. It was cancelled in 1982. Unfinished nuclear power plant in Oklahoma

The Browns Ferry Nuclear Plant is located on the Tennessee River near Decatur and Athens, Alabama , on the north side (right bank) of Wheeler Lake . The site has three General Electric boiling water reactor (BWR) nuclear generating units and is owned entirely by the Tennessee Valley Authority (TVA).

#6 Fermi 1
Fermi 1 was the United States ' only demonstration-scale breeder reactor , built during the 1950s at the Enrico Fermi Nuclear Generating Station on the western shore of Lake Erie south of Detroit, Michigan . The Diablo Canyon Power Plant is a nuclear power plant near Avila Beach in San Luis Obispo County, California . Since the permanent shutdown of the San Onofre Nuclear Generating Station in 2013, Diablo Canyon has been the only operational nuclear plant and largest single power station in California.
#8 Wind power in South Australia
Wind power became a significant energy source within South Australia over the first two decades of the 21st century.
